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5678168 79865250 12491636
273 349156 823857777
273 349156 823857777
027 890754315 16424382094 8689 489990
All about undefined
Interested in learning more?
273 349156 823857777
027 890754315 16424382094 8689 489990
See more
40759 90613923329
708 87421612226 83
See more
8218632 2719698 25850
20863043 2379900922 996119
See more